Regulatory Issues in Digital Betting
The swift expansion of digital betting has created a complex landscape of regulatory issues across different jurisdictions. Governments face the daunting task of creating legal frameworks that can effectively govern online betting while also promoting innovation and protecting consumers. As technology evolves, rules must stay pace to tackle issues such as age checks, responsible betting measures, and the combating of fraud and money laundering. Inability to do so can result to serious risks for both providers and users.
Another significant issue arises from the global nature of digital betting platforms. What is legal in one country may be prohibited in a different country, leading to a fragmented of regulations that can be difficult for operators and users alike. This internationalization of gambling creates difficulties in enforcing regional laws, as users can readily access platforms based in jurisdictions with more lenient regulations. Consequently, authorities are tasked with not only regulating local providers but also monitoring external entities that aim at their citizens.
Additionally, the ongoing discussion around digital gambling rules is further complicated by the diverse views on gambling within society. Some view it as a form of entertainment and a legitimate economic activity, while others argue it can result to dependency and societal harm. Reconciling these viewpoints requires policymakers to engage with various stakeholders, including public health experts, advocacy groups, and business representatives, to establish comprehensive guidelines that focus on consumer safety without stifling development and innovation in the digital betting sector.
